我有两段代码,实际上工作正常。第一段代码请求来自oanda的历史数据。它工作正常,我可以按照我想要的方式阅读和操作数据。
第二段代码是投资组合优化工具的开始,该工具从google api获取股票数据。 由于谷歌不提供任何外汇数据,我想将oanda代码与投资组合优化代码合并。
在尝试了几个小时之后,我仍然没有按照正确存储列中请求所有数据的方式完成它。
由于我还是初学者,我在这里再次问你们。
如果你们能帮助我正确合并代码,我将非常感激。我想用oanda的'openBid'数据替换我从谷歌收到的符号'关闭'数据。
非常感谢,你在这里做得很好!
度过愉快的一天!
JSONObject
import configparser
import oandapy as opy
oanda = opy.API(environment='practice',
access_token='abc')
import pandas as pd
import time
data = oanda.get_history(instrument='EUR_USD',
start='2016-10-01' ,
end=time.strftime("%Y-%m-%d"),
granularity='D') # minute bars
df = pd.DataFrame(data['candles'])
x = np.array(df['openBid'])